RMR — The Registered Merit Reporter (RMR) credential is awarded by the National Court Reporters Association (NCRA). It consists of a written knowledge test (100 questions, 2.5 hours, 75% passing score) plus a skills test requiring 95% accuracy at speeds of 200 wpm literary, 240 wpm jury charge, and 260 wpm testimony over 5-minute takes.
